The most recent example comes by way of David Bossie, one of Trumps very first political advisers and a senior staffer on his presidential campaign. According to a new report, Bossies Presidential Coalition raked in millions of dollars from donors giving less than $200 each in a single yearonly to spend most of it on Bossies salary, pricey consultants, and efforts to raise more money.
According to I.R.S. filings reviewed by Axios and the Campaign Legal Center, Bossies 527 political organization raised $18.5 million between 2017 and 2018, promising donors that the group was dedicated to identifying and supporting conservative candidates running for office at the state and local levels of government. Its fund-raising mailers featured an image of the White House inside its logo, donation suggestions of $45 made in honor of the 45th president, and, just to drive the point home, a photo of Bossie next to Trump.
But, shockingly, those claims were somewhat misleading. Of the $15.4 million that the Presidential Coalition spent during that period, only $425,442 (or 3 percent) was spent on candidates, political committees, or state and local ads supporting said candidates. (In contrast, the Republican Governors Association, a similar 527 organization, spent about 80 percent of its expenditures on those direct political activities.) As for the remaining 97 percent, the C.L.C. traced it directly into the pockets of the swampy, political-consultant classincluding Bossie himself. According to I.R.S. documents, the Presidential Coalition spent millions of dollars on contracts with 14 direct-marketing firms to fuel fund-raising efforts, several million dollars more on postage to send said mailers and books, at least $1.1 million to telemarketing firms associated with InfoCision (which was previously accused by former employees of preying on elderly donors), and $1.2 million on donor-cultivation lists. (InfoCision has denied the allegations, but agreed to pay a $250,000 settlement to the Federal Trade Commission in 2018 over misleading practices.) Bossie himself diverted $659,493 to two of his other political organizations, Citizens United and Citizens United Foundation, from which he drew a $105,541 salary. (Incidentally, Citizens United is the group behind the Supreme Court ruling that corporations can spend unlimited amounts of money on political campaigns and messaging.)
Unfortunately, these practices are not unique to the Presidential Coalition: there is a cottage industry of groups targeting vulnerable communities with self-serving borderline scams, the C.L.C. report states. What sets the Presidential Coalition apart is that it is explicitlyand successfullycapitalizing on Bossies connection with the President of the United States.
